The brand new combination of good D/A good converter and you will a great DDS to a single processor chip can often be also known as a whole DDS service, a home common to all the DDS products out-of ADI.
Continuous-time sinusoidal signals have a repetitive angular phase list of 0 so you can 2?. Brand new digital execution is no different. The newest counters bring means allows this new phase accumulator to do something since a stage controls on DDS execution.
Understand so it first form, photo brand new sine-revolution oscillation given that good vector rotating to a period system (see Figure 4). For each and every appointed point on new stage wheel represents the equivalent point on a period regarding a sine-wave. While the vector rotates in the controls, picture that sine of position makes a corresponding efficiency sine wave. One trend of vector inside the stage wheel, at the a stable rate, contributes to one to done years of your own returns sine-wave. The latest stage accumulator has the similarly spread angular values associated the latest vectors linear rotation in the phase controls. The new items in the brand new phase accumulator correspond to the new items towards the course of your own returns sine-wave.
The new stage accumulator is simply an effective modulo-Yards avoid one increments their held count anytime they obtains a-clock heartbeat. The latest magnitude of your increment varies according to the brand new binary-coded input word (M). That it word models the fresh phase action size anywhere between source-time clock status; it effectively set just how many things to disregard within the phase wheel. The larger the newest diving dimensions, the faster the newest stage accumulator overflows and completes their same in principle as good sine-wave period. Just how many discrete phase factors included in the wheel is actually influenced by the fresh quality of the phase accumulator (n), and this find the tuning quality of your own DDS. To have an n = 28-portion stage accumulator, an Meters property value 0000. 0001 carry out make phase accumulator overflowing immediately after dos twenty eight reference-clock time periods (increments). In case your Meters worth is actually changed to 0111. 1111, the fresh stage accumulator have a tendency to overflow once just dos site-clock time periods (minimal necessary for Nyquist). So it matchmaking is found in the basic tuning picture having DDS architecture:
Changes towards worth of M result in instantaneous and you can phase-continuing changes in the newest efficiency regularity. Zero circle paying off go out try incurred as in the situation from a period-locked loop.
As the output frequency is increased, the number of samples per cycle pling theory dictates that at least two samples per cycle are required to reconstruct the output waveform, the maximum fundamental output frequency of a DDS is fC/2. However, for practical applications, the output frequency is limited to somewhat less than that, improving the quality of the reconstructed waveform and permitting filtering on the output.
When producing a reliable volume, the fresh new yields of phase accumulator increases linearly, so that the analogue waveform it will make was naturally a great ramp.
Upcoming how would be the fact linear productivity interpreted on the a sine-wave?
A period-to-amplitude lookup desk is utilized to convert the fresh stage-accumulators immediate production really worth (twenty eight bits getting AD9833)-that have unneeded reduced-extreme pieces eliminated of the truncation-towards the sine-trend amplitude information that is made available to the latest (10-bit) D/A beneficial converter. The newest DDS frameworks exploits the newest shaped character out of a sine wave and you may uses mapping reasoning so you can synthesize an entire sine-wave off one-quarter-course of information from the phase accumulator. New stage-to- amplitude search table stimulates the remainder studies by the understanding forward next back from browse desk. This can be revealed pictorially into the Profile 5.
Just what are preferred uses for DDS?
Programs currently playing with DDS-oriented waveform generation get into one or two dominant kinds: Designers from communications assistance requiring nimble (we.age., instantly responding) regularity present having expert phase looks and you can low spurious performance tend to prefer DDS for its combination of spectral results and you may regularity-tuning solution. Eg apps were using an excellent DDS for modulation, given that a guide to own good PLL to enhance complete regularity tunability, since a neighbor hood oscillator (LO), or for head RF signal.